Output e7816659c6fa2f91f64f2ec291fb7d7e04605414558d0383c1c39c2d8fceacea:1

value
2166015
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 469dae154017f95fe3623110657bd2e97e91d842 OP_EQUALVERIFY OP_CHECKSIG
address
17SPCEC2EVF3KLtzwzwmouLos1dWEYHQog
transaction
e7816659c6fa2f91f64f2ec291fb7d7e04605414558d0383c1c39c2d8fceacea
spent
true